Thanks for stopping by. Thanks for your prayers and encouragements.
I am thankful to God for working all things for His glory and our good.
I just reread this short except and felt much encouraged to remember God's love and faithfulness in working all things for His glory and our good even when we don't understand it. Our faith is based on Truths that are revealed in the Words of God. God is unchanging and His Words stands forever.
Hope this excerpt taken from Thomas Watson’s “All Things For Good”, The Banner of Truth Trust, 1991, 1st Published 1663, pages 25 to 26 will encourage you too:
To know that nothing hurts the godly, is a matter of comfort; but to be assured that ALL things which fall out shall co-operate for their good, that their crosses shall be turned into blessings, that showers of affliction water the withering root of their grace and make it flourish more; this may fill their hearts with joy till they run over.
“We know.” It is not a matter wavering or doubtful. The apostle does not say, We hope, or conjecture, but it is like an article in our creed, WE KNOW that all things work for good.
Hence observe that the truths of the gospel are evident and infallible. A Christian may come not merely to a vague opinion but to a certainty of what he holds. The Spirit of God imprints heavenly truths upon the heart as with the point of a diamond.
We have arrived at a holy confidence. Let us not rest in scepticism or doubts, but labour to come to a certainty in the things of religion. It concerns us to be well grounded and confirmed in it.
So all God’s providences, being divinely tempered and sanctified, work together for the best of the saints. He who loves God and is called according to His purpose, may rest assured that every thing in the world shall be for his good.
“All the paths of the Lord are mercy and truth unto such as keep his covenant” (Psalm 25:10). If every path has mercy in it, then it works for good.

From the rising of the sun unto the going down of the same the LORD's name is to be praised. Psalm 113:3
(my friend, Sau, took this lovely picture at Saipan)
Hope you enjoy this lovely video on Psalm 147:1-11 posted on Youtube:
(my friend, Sau, took this lovely picture at Saipan)
Hope you enjoy this lovely video on Psalm 147:1-11 posted on Youtube:
Psalm 147:1-11
1 Praise ye the Lord; for it is good
praise to our God to sing:
For it is pleasant, and to praise
it is a comely thing.
2 God doth build up Jerusalem;
and he it is alone
That the dispersed of Israel
doth gather into one.
3 Those that are broken in their heart,
and grievèd in their minds,
He healeth, and their painful wounds
he tenderly up-binds.
4 He counts the number of the stars;
he names them ev'ry one.
5 Great is our Lord, and of great pow'r;
his wisdom search can none.
6 The Lord lifts up the meek; and casts
the wicked to the ground.
7 Sing to the Lord, and give him thanks;
on harp his praises sound;
8 Who covereth the heav'n with clouds,
who for the earth below
Prepareth rain, who maketh grass
upon the mountains grow.
9 He gives the beast his food, he feeds
the ravens young that cry.
10 His pleasure not in horses' strength,
nor in man's legs, doth lie.
11 But in all those that do him fear
the Lord doth pleasure take;
In those that to his mercy do
by hope themselves betake.
Best Regards
8 November 2008